SOMMEDI, located in Nasarawa State, Nigeria, serves as a pivotal institution aimed at fostering industrial self-reliance by supporting small and medium enterprises (SMEs) in the mining sector. Established in partnership with the National Agency for Science and Engineering Infrastructure (NASENI) in 2012, its mission is to transition Nigeria’s mining operations from informal practices to a modern, high-tech industry.
Officially launched on May 25, 2019, SOMMEDI is ideally situated in one of Nigeria’s most mineral-rich regions. Its primary focus is developing specialised machinery for mining and mineral processing, aiding in local capacity building and technology development for the mining industry, filling a critical gap in indigenous technological solutions.
SOMMEDI fosters innovation and aims to improve mining efficiency through its comprehensive facilities, which include a fully equipped Mineral Processing Workshop, a Wood Processing Workshop, and a Gemological Laboratory. These amenities symbolise practical advancements towards Nigeria’s economic diversification.
The institute also plays a significant role in localising mining technology, helping reduce dependence on foreign imports. With targeted interventions, it assists SMEs in enhancing productivity and minimising operational costs, strengthening Nigeria’s economic output.
According to Mr. Abdullahi Usman Rasheed, Acting Head of Administration, SOMMEDI seeks to cultivate self-sufficiency in machinery for solid mineral processing and optimises their use both domestically and internationally. This aligns with national objectives for job creation and youth empowerment through specialised technical skill training.

Through collaborations with government and educational entities, SOMMEDI is developing marketable products that boost economic activity in the solid minerals sector. By delivering affordable and efficient mining equipment, it empowers SMEs, enhancing production rates and supporting poverty alleviation in local communities.
SOMMEDI’s ongoing developments, including machinery for cement and glass production, exemplify its focus on value addition and stimulating local industries, promoting a shift from raw mineral exportation to finished product production. This strategy supports job creation and economic growth while also reducing import dependency.
